VC++6.0 MFC绘图入门:上机操作与基本函数讲解
需积分: 14 173 浏览量
更新于2024-07-13
收藏 1.58MB PPT 举报
本资源主要介绍了在VC++6.0环境下进行绘图的基础知识,重点讲解了如何使用MFC(Microsoft Foundation Classes Library,微软基类库)进行图形开发。首先,VC++6.0作为一款流行的可视化编程平台,相较于Turbo C语言,提供了更丰富的功能,包括真彩色显示和交互式绘图能力。
在MFC上机操作步骤中,开发者需要启动Visual C++ 6.0,通过新建项目开始。具体流程包括:
1. 打开【File】菜单,选择【New】创建一个MFC应用项目,设置项目名称为Test,存放位置为D:\Test。
2. 使用MFCAppWizard创建一个单文档应用程序,选择SingleDocument模式,然后点击【Finish】完成项目框架的初始化。
3. 项目生成后,工作区会显示四个面板:ClassView用于查看类和成员函数,Resource View显示资源文件,FileView展示源代码文件和资源文件如ICO和BMP等。
4. 在ClassView中,可以看到CTestApp作为主函数类,处理应用程序的消息;CTestDoc文档类管理数据;CTestView类负责用户界面操作,如处理鼠标和键盘事件。
5. 用户通常会在CTestView类的模板中进行大部分的绘图操作和用户交互。
接下来的内容将深入到基本绘图函数的学习,这部分可能包括Windows API中与图形相关的函数调用,如绘制线条、圆、矩形等几何形状,以及颜色、坐标系和图形设备环境的设置。此外,还会介绍如何利用MFC提供的绘图工具,如CDC(Device Context)对象,来进行更复杂的图形渲染和图形控件的使用。
最后,本章会以一个小结的形式回顾所学内容,并提供相关的练习题供读者巩固所学知识。对于初学者来说,这是理解和掌握VC++6.0绘图基础的重要参考资料,适合用于课堂实践或个人自学。通过实践这些步骤和函数,读者将能够为自己的项目开发出具有交互性和视觉吸引力的图形界面。
点击了解资源详情
257 浏览量
点击了解资源详情
135 浏览量
108 浏览量
点击了解资源详情
2012-10-01 上传
2010-05-11 上传
177 浏览量
西住流军神
- 粉丝: 31
- 资源: 2万+
最新资源
- 《Linux服务器搭建实战详解》-pdf
- java爬虫的实例代码+java清除空文件夹的代码
- Project1:使用HTML,CSS和引导程序创建的响应式投资组合网页
- Catfish(鲶鱼) Blog v1.1.9
- ROG-Phone-2-Switch-WW-Stock-ROM
- 社交媒体演示
- gatsby-shopify-toy-store-test
- 使用MATLAB分析车队测试数据:在线讲座“使用MATLAB分析车队测试数据”中的文件-matlab开发
- 汽车销售管理系统-毕业设计
- 台达A2伺服说明说.rar
- 商品销售系统源码.rar
- c33
- 校无忧人事工资系统 v2.5
- react-contentful-nextjs-tutorial:使用适用于SSR或Jamstack的NextJS React x Contentful
- 视频编码器
- Rapla, resource scheduling-开源